We don't just find tenants. We find tenants fast.
If your property is ready for a tenant, we immediately appoint a Realtor to get the real estate investment on the market. One of our property manager will contact you to make arrangements to take photos. Unless the real estate investor has other instructions, within 48 hours we will have the rental on hundreds's of websites including Realtor.com, Zillow, Trulia, Hotpads and our own website. We will push the property into the feed of every property manager in Stanley.
The real estate agent will take a look at your real estate investment and make suggestions that will improve your home's rental value. The Realtor will also determine repairs that are required before we can help you. We can make recommendations for maintenance people if called upon.
The property manager will also do a comparative market analysis to nail down the actual rental value of your property. By comparing your rental to similar offerings that are currently available and comparing your rental to offerings that recently rented in Stanley we will best know the actual value of your real estate investment. From there we will make a recommended list price for the property.
